The Role of Extended Producer Responsibility

A cornerstone of sustainable electronics disposal is the principle of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R). EPR shifts the financial and operational burden of managing e-waste from municipalities and taxpayers to the producers of the equipment. This incentivizes manufacturers to design products that are more durable, repairable, and recyclable. The WEEE Directive in Europe is the most prominent example of this, mandating producer take-back and recycling targets.

This regulatory framework is a critical driver for the industry, creating a stable funding stream for collection and recycling infrastructure. It also encourages innovation, as producers seek cost-effective ways to meet their obligations, often by investing in more efficient recycling technologies or by integrating recycled materials into new products. The effectiveness of EPR schemes is a key factor in determining the success of e-waste management in different regions.

Consumer Participation and Awareness

The loop cannot be closed without active consumer participation. Consumer awareness and participation is a growing trend, as public understanding of the environmental and health impacts of improper e-waste disposal increases. Educational campaigns and convenient collection points are encouraging individuals to recycle their old electronics rather than storing them or sending them to landfill.

This demand for responsible disposal is also influencing corporate behavior. Companies that promote and facilitate the recycling of their products are viewed more favorably by environmentally conscious consumers. The market is responding with more accessible take-back programs and partnership models between retailers and recyclers.

Challenges in Achieving Sustainability

The path to truly sustainable electronics disposal is fraught with challenges. These include the complexity and cost of recycling, the presence of hazardous materials, the informal and often unsafe recycling sector in developing countries, and the need for greater international cooperation to prevent the illegal export of e-waste. Overcoming these challenges requires a multi-stakeholder approach.
